The Global Landscape of Surgical Grade Cobalt Alloys

In the high-stakes world of medical technology, Surgical Grade Cobalt Alloys (specifically CoCrMo and Elgiloy) stand as the backbone of modern orthopedics and cardiology. Known for their exceptional wear resistance, biocompatibility, and high strength-to-weight ratio, these alloys are indispensable for hip and knee replacements, spinal fixations, and dental prosthetics.

As the global population ages, the demand for long-lasting implants has surged. Industry leaders are no longer just looking for a supplier; they are seeking partners who understand the nuances of ASTM F1537, ISO 5832-4, and ASTM F75 standards. The current market is shifting towards additive manufacturing (3D printing) grade powders and ultra-fine wires for minimally invasive surgical tools.

Trends Shaping the Cobalt Alloy Industry

The industry is moving beyond simple forging. We are seeing a massive shift toward Digital Manufacturing. Cobalt-Chromium-Molybdenum (CoCrMo) powders are now the preferred material for SLM (Selective Laser Melting) 3D printers, allowing for the creation of trabecular structures in implants that promote bone ingrowth (osseointegration).

Furthermore, the development of Nickel-Free Cobalt Alloys is a major trend, aiming to eliminate patient allergies. Essential Procurement Guide for Medical Implants

1. Material Grade Verification

Always verify if the alloy is Wrought (ASTM F1537) or Cast (ASTM F75). Wrought alloys generally offer better mechanical properties for high-load applications like knee joints.

2. Surface Finish & Tolerances

For surgical tools and springs, tolerances should be within microns. Elgiloy strips must have edge-finish options (deburred or rounded) to prevent tissue damage during surgery.

3. Traceability Documentation

A reputable factory must provide a 3.1 or 3.2 Material Test Certificate (MTC) detailing the melt number, chemical composition, and mechanical test results for every shipment.
